The Hook is the latest circuit tester from Power Probe. This
powerful automotive tool can connect to systems from 12 to 48 volts. Power Probe’s new
“Smart Tip Advantage” senses the probe-tip condition and selects the correct
meter for you.
When the probe-tip senses resistance to ground, the display
reads from 0 Ohms to 15 Meg Ohms with a resolution of 0.001 Ohms. When the
probe-tip contacts voltage, the display becomes an instant voltmeter and
measures from 0 to 99.9 volts. When you press the power switch to activate
electrical components, the Hook displays its current draw in amps.
The
adjustable electronic circuit breaker can now be set as low as 2 amps and as
high as 65. It can activate 100 amps in-rush current, and 25 amps continuous.
